New approaches to polysubstituted pyrroles and pyrrolinones from α-cyanomethyl-β-ketoesters
作者:Ayhan S. Demir、Mustafa Emrullahoglu、Gülben Ardahan
DOI:10.1016/j.tet.2006.10.054
日期:2007.1
efficient, regioselective one-pot synthesis of 5-alkoxy and 5-alkylsulfanylpyrrole-3-carboxylates in high yields via the zinc perchlorate-catalyzed addition of alcohols and thiols to the nitrile carbon of α-cyanomethyl-β-ketoesters followed by annulation. The addition–annulation process is undertaken in aqueous solution to give 4,5-dihydro-5-oxo-1H-pyrrole-3-carboxylates (pyrrolinones) in good yields. These

Zinc perchlorate catalyzed one-pot amination–annulation of α-cyanomethyl-β-ketoesters in water. Regioselective synthesis of 2-aminopyrrole-4-carboxylates
作者:Ayhan S. Demir、Mustafa Emrullahoglu
DOI:10.1016/j.tet.2005.11.018
日期:2006.2
In this paper, we report the efficient and regioselective synthesis of 2-aminopyrrole-4-carboxylates as derivatives of conformationally restricted analogues of gamma-amino butyrates (GABA) via a zinc perchlorate catalyzed amination-annulation of alpha-cyanomethyl-beta-ketoesters under mild reaction conditions in water. An effective new synthesis of 2-aminopyrrole-4-carboxylates
作者:Ayhan S. Demir、Mustafa Emrullahoglu
DOI:10.1016/j.tet.2005.08.050
日期:2005.10
α-cyanomethyl-β-dicarbonyl compounds with amines catalyzed by p-TsOH affords the corresponding enamines in good yields. Base catalyzed cyclization via the addition of an amine moiety to the carbon–nitrogentriplebond of nitrile furnished 2-aminopyrroles in high yields.
